问题
安装typescript后使用tsc命令编译ts文件,结果报错:“无法加载文件C:\Users\Administrator\AppData\Roaming\npm\tsc.ps1,因为在此系统上禁止运行脚本。”
如下图:
原因
有关详细信息,请参阅 https:/go.microsoft.com/fwlink/?LinkID=135170 中的 about_Execution_Policies。
PowerShell 的执行策略是一项安全功能,用于控制 PowerShell 加载配置文件和运行脚本的条件。此功能有助于防止执行恶意脚本。
解决方案
更改执行策略。
管理员身份运行Windows PowerShell 输入 set-ExecutionPolicy RemoteSigned
选择 A 或者 Y,回车。